How What It Takes Talks about Insights into achieving success in finance and business?

In “What It Takes: Lessons in the Pursuit of Excellence” by Stephen A. Schwarzman, the author shares valuable insights into achieving success in finance and business. Schwarzman, the billionaire co-founder and CEO of private equity firm Blackstone Group, reveals the key principles and strategies that have helped him build an incredibly successful career.

One of the main themes of the book is the importance of having a clear vision and setting ambitious goals. Schwarzman emphasizes the need to think big and constantly push oneself to achieve new heights. He also stresses the importance of resilience and perseverance in the face of challenges and setbacks. Schwarzman shares personal anecdotes and experiences that demonstrate how he overcame obstacles and continued to pursue his goals despite adversity.

Another key lesson from the book is the importance of building strong relationships and networks. Schwarzman emphasizes the value of collaboration and surrounding oneself with talented individuals who can help drive success. He also stresses the importance of lifelong learning and continually seeking new knowledge and skills to stay ahead in a competitive business environment.

Overall, “What It Takes” offers valuable insights and advice for aspiring entrepreneurs and business leaders looking to achieve success in finance and business. Schwarzman’s personal stories and practical tips provide a roadmap for how to navigate the challenges of the business world and build a successful career.
